[quote]基于外键关联的单向一对多关联是一种很少见的情况,我们不推荐使用它。[/quote]
[quote]我们认为对于这种关联关系最好使用连接表。 [/quote]
PERSON 1:N ADDRESS
ER关系图多对多关系分解为两个一对多关系,没有一对多分解为一对一和一对多。这种推荐的处理方式是如何考虑的呢?
[quote]基于外键关联的单向一对多关联是一种很少见的情况,我们不推荐使用它。[/quote]
[quote]我们认为对于这种关联关系最好使用连接表。 [/quote]
PERSON 1:N ADDRESS
ER关系图多对多关系分解为两个一对多关系,没有一对多分解为一对一和一对多。这种推荐的处理方式是如何考虑的呢?
其实更多的考虑是面向对象的特性,一种对现实世界的一种自然模拟,其实在很多时候,一对多 多对多都可以做出来,但是你建模总得有个最佳方案。比如你举的例子
PERSON 1:N ADDRESS 这其实最直观的对生活中现实模拟,倒不是真的考虑到易用性。